Grogan Graffam, a small firm based in Pittsburgh, is closing its doors after this week, its founding shareholder has confirmed.

Founding shareholder Vincent J. Grogan said the firm will be closed effective April 18 after 45 years in business. Grogan said all of the firm’s attorneys have found a place to land, as has most of its staff.
